What will the weather in Pavenham be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Pavenham are usually July and August with an average temp of 60°F. January and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 41°F. The rainiest months are October and August.

Best time to go to Pavenham

Pavenham exper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 38.7°F (3.7°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 62.4°F (16.9°C). October t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Pavenham are May to July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, February, August, and December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
